Output 266e6845693bd6d68f6d3449c76883f15f572e4c03e85ffb7cfd3c61649f16f0:1

value
3898476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ff47c29ac6fd772a9ef2080adb2dac7e914bed5d OP_EQUAL
address
3QxpCSkeRwoNdFhRoATLvbN8buXvoMFwii
transaction
266e6845693bd6d68f6d3449c76883f15f572e4c03e85ffb7cfd3c61649f16f0
spent
true